Key Responsibilities and Accountabilities

The Commercial Client Specialist III is the main point of contact for commercial clients. S/he will be responsible for client onboarding, opening new accounts, collecting loan due diligence and providing support to RMs and PMs. The Commercial Client Specialist III will facilitate the accurate and timely closing and funding of commercial credit transactions. Incumbents will be assigned a portfolio of commercial clients for on-going service and administration.

  • Serves as the primary contact for commercial clients in a concierge-like Relationship Management model and plays a key role in maintaining and ensuring customer satisfaction.
  • Understands CIP policies and procedures, BSA, and all due diligence required to open deposit accounts for clients and recommends bank products/services to meet those opportunities.
  • Provides customer service to their portfolio of clients including account maintenance, wire processing, exception monitoring, and other servicing items.
  • Assists RM/PM with post-approval due diligence for loan closings. Works directly with borrower to collect outstanding items.
  • Directly contributes to the production of the commercial team by communicating with sales, credit, external partners, and 3rd party vendors to ensure the bank meets the closing date and time expectations of the borrower.
  • Understands credit packages and what is needed to close; work with attorneys and closing. department to ensure closing matches loan approval and documentation is correct.
  • Advises sales and credit of obstacles that may impede meeting client expectations. Coordinates booking and funding of loans with Loan Operations.
  • Reviews and processes advances.
  • Reviews status of current accounts to include, but not limited to, past due payments, tracking of insurance, tracking of maturities/renewals, and interacting with clients.
  • Work closely with Relationship Managers (RM) and Portfolio Managers (PM) to ensure satisfactory on-going monitoring of loans to clients and assist with timely collection of financial statements.
